GAS REQUIREMENTS

NATURAL GAS HOOK-UP

Connection: 3/8-flare male fitting in right rear corner of unit
Operating pressure :7.0" W.C.
Check with your local gas utility company or with local codes for instructions on install-
ing gas supply lines. Be sure to check on type and size of run, and how deep to bury the
line. If the line is too small the ProFire Gas Grill will not function properly. Please have a
certified gas installer make sure that the size of the line is correct. Any joint sealant used
must be an approved type and be resistant to actions of L.P. and Natural gases. Do not
forget to place the installer supplied gas valve in an accessible location. Check local
codes. Consult your local gas dealer. In the absence of local codes, installation must
conform to the latest edition of the NATIONAL FUEL GAS CODE, ANSI Z233.1
The grill is designed to operate on Natural Gas at a pressure of 7" water column (W.C.)
(1.75kPa) unregulated. Check with your gas utility for local gas pressure. Use of your
grill at pressures other than approximate 7" water column will affect the performance of
your grill and requires installation of a natural gas regulator set at 7" W.C.
The grill and its individual shut-off valve must be disconnected from the gas supply pip-
ing system during any pressure testing of that system at test pressures in excess of 1/2
psig (3.5kPa). The grill must be isolated from the gas by closing its valves during any
pressure testing of the gas supply system at test pressures equal to or less than 1/2 psig
(3.5kPa).
Never use LP gas in a unit designed for natural gas. If you wish to convert
your grill from one type of gas to the other you may order a gas conversion kit
from ProFire or your dealer.
